show system

To display the system information, use the show system command.

show system {cores default switchport directory information error-id {hex-idlist} exception-info pss shrink status [details] redundancy status reset-reason [module slot] resources uptime}

Syntax Description

 

cores

Displays core transfer option.

 

 

default switchport

Displays system default values.

 

 

 

 

 

 

directory information

Directory information of System Manager.

 

 

 

 

 

 

error-id

Displays description about errors.

 

 

 

 

 

 

hex-id

Specifies the error ID in hexadecimal format. The range is 0x0 to 0xffffffff.

 

 

 

 

 

 

list

Specifies all error IDs.

 

 

 

 

 

 

exception-info

Displays last exception log information.

 

 

 

 

 

 

pss shrink status

Displays the last PSS shrink status.

 

 

 

 

 

 

details

Displays detailed information on the last PSS shrink status.

 

 

 

 

 

 

redundancy status

Redundancy status.

 

 

 

 

 

 

reset-reason

Displays the last four reset reason codes.

 

 

 

 

 

 

module slot

Specifies the module number to display the reset-reason codes.

 

 

 

 

 

 

resources

Show the CPU and memory statistics.

 

 

 

 

 

 

uptime

Displays how long the system has been up and running.

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

Defaults

 

None.

 

 

 

 

 

Command Modes

 

EXEC mode.

 

 

 

 

Command History

 

This command was introduced in Cisco MDS SAN-OS Release 1.0(2).
